About Martin Goosey

Martin Goosey is a scholar working on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Electrochemistry and Catalysis, having authored 46 papers that have together received 800 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(17 papers), Electronic Packaging and Soldering Technologies (7 papers) and Extraction and Separation Processes (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(323 citations), Mechanical Engineering (342 citations) and Polymers and Plastics (102 citations). Martin Goosey has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and France. Frequent co-authors include Rod Kellner, N. Bains, Nathan T. Wright, Ian Dalrymple, F. W. Ainger, Ian Holmes, Prem Prakash Seth, H. Herman, N.M. Shorrocks and R. W. Whatmore. Their work appears in journals such as Polymer Degradation and Stability, International Journal of Adhesion and Adhesives and Ferroelectrics.
